3. Advantages of VR in Psychotechnical Assessments
Imagine stepping into a virtual world where you can experience real-life scenarios without any risks. That's precisely what Virtual Reality (VR) brings to the table, especially in the realm of psychotechnical assessments. Traditional methods often involve static tests that can feel flat and uninspiring, failing to capture the true essence of a candidate's abilities. However, incorporating VR transforms these assessments into immersive experiences. For instance, candidates can navigate challenging social situations or problem-solving tasks that mimic actual work environments. This not only enhances engagement but also provides a more accurate reflection of how individuals might perform in real-world scenarios.
Moreover, the data collected through VR assessments can be incredibly rich. Unlike conventional tests, which may overlook subtle behavioral nuances, VR environments allow for the observation of a candidate’s decision-making process in real time. Final Conclusions
In conclusion, the evolution of psychotechnical tests in virtual reality environments represents a significant leap in the field of psychological assessment and evaluation. By harnessing the immersive and interactive capabilities of virtual reality, these tests offer a more realistic and engaging platform for measuring cognitive and behavioral responses. This technological advancement not only enhances the accuracy of assessments but also accommodates a wider range of applications, from personnel selection in corporate settings to therapeutic interventions in clinical psychology. As these virtual tools continue to evolve, they promise to redefine traditional methodologies, making testing more adaptable and insightful.
Moreover, the integration of psychotechnical tests into virtual reality prompts us to reconsider ethical and practical implications. While the immersive experience can lead to more nuanced data collection, it also raises concerns regarding data privacy, accessibility, and the potential for misuse in high-stakes scenarios. As researchers continue to refine these tools and establish best practices, it is vital to ensure that they are used responsibly and fairly. Ultimately, the future of psychotechnical testing in virtual environments holds great potential for not only advancing psychological research but also improving the ways we understand and support human behavior across diverse contexts.
